SEOUL, June 7 (Yonhap) -- South Korea and Japan on Sunday held a joint maritime search and rescue exercise (SAREX) for the first time in nine years, the Navy said.The drill was conducted by the South Korean Navy and Japan's Maritime Self-Defense Force in international waters southeast of Jeju Island...
